New Jersey Devils vs Winnipeg Jets Recap - Jets Win 8-4

Winnipeg got 3 goals from Mark Scheifele en route to a 8-4 victory over New Jersey on Friday at Canada Life Centre.

Winnipeg was favored by -189 and came through for bettors backing them. The game went OVER the consensus closing total of 5.5.

Mark Scheifele(3), Nikolaj Ehlers(2), Josh Morrissey, Adam Lowry, and Kristian Vesalainen each scored for the Jets in the victory. Scheifele opened the scoring for Winnipeg.

Connor Hellebuyck stopped 33 of 37 New Jersey shots in the victory.

Jack Hughes, Damon Severson, Nico Hischier, and Ryan Graves scored for the Devils, finding the net behind Connor Hellebuyck.

Jonathan Bernier stopped 26 of 32 shots for the Devils, but it wasn't enough to earn the victory.

Winnipeg scored 1 times on 4 chances on the power play, while New Jersey went 1-for-2 with the man advantage.

New Jersey lost the shots on goal battle to Winnipeg by a margin of 40-37.

Winnipeg heads into a battle against the Maple Leafs. New Jersey, meanwhile, will have their next action against Ottawa.
